Awaroa Vineyard

The organic Awaroa vineyards are situated on west facing slopes, nestled among native bush in the middle of Waiheke Island. Syrah and Cabernet Sauvignon are the main varieties planted.

Waiheke Island of Wine
We aim for a ripe, concentrated style of red wine. This means low crop levels, plenty of sunshine on the grapes and leaving the grapes on the vine as long as we can. The grapes are harvested and then gently crushed by foot. The fermenting wine is plunged by hand 6-8 times a day, then a gentle press into mostly new oak barrels for the next 12 months or so before bottling.
